> The new release of XFree86, ie 3.2, is available; there's a server for the
> S3 ViRGE chip included, which has been ported to the Alpha.
it wasn't really "ported" but only complied. I didn't have the time
to run or test it on AXP before XFree86 3.2 was finalized and guess what,
it doesn't work at all on AXP, sorry :-(
> Last I heard,
> however, was that the released server did not work well, so unless the
> problems have been fixed and a new binary generated, I'd not count on the
> one that's available at ftp.xfree86.org (and some mirrors).
>
> Harald, sorry if this is inaccurate...
absolutely correct. right now I have a version of the ViRGE server
running on AXP and there are some minor problems left (text fonts may get
corrupted; and switching to other virtual consoles and back to X11
still might hang the server; hope to find/fix this RSN).
for "X-only" operation it looks better (but I didn't run any tests yet).
hope there will be a new binary within some time (1-2 weeks?)
